如果这是一个愚蠢的问题我很抱歉,但是我已经度过了漫长的一周,这只不过是我这个虚弱的大脑所能处理的。
我正在尝试为Rails安装foreign_key_migrations插件,可在此处找到: https://github.com/harukizaemon/redhillonrails/tree/master/foreign_key_migrations/
如何安装插件?我在克隆Git存储库后读取的README文件似乎没有提供任何安装说明。我不明白。
答案 0 :(得分:1)
从未听说过这个插件,看起来很有用。我可能会尝试一下。至于你的问题:你的意思是如何在/ vendor / plugins文件夹中获取插件?如果是这样,那很简单:
script/plugin install https://github.com/harukizaemon/redhillonrails.git
安装完成后,您只需通过迁移添加外键,插件即可自动完成所有操作。要在现有数据库上添加外键,只需执行以下操作:
script/generate foreign_key_migration
希望它有所帮助。
修改强>
使用Rails 3时,你应该这样做:
rails plugin install https://github.com/harukizaemon/redhillonrails.git
但我不知道这个插件是否适用于Rails 3。